About

Simonas Juzėnas is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Cancer Research and Hematology. According to data from OpenAlex, Simonas Juzėnas has authored 30 papers receiving a total of 581 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 18 papers in Molecular Biology, 17 papers in Cancer Research and 4 papers in Hematology. Recurrent topics in Simonas Juzėnas's work include MicroRNA in disease regulation (13 papers), Cancer-related molecular mechanisms research (11 papers) and RNA modifications and cancer (5 papers). Simonas Juzėnas is often cited by papers focused on MicroRNA in disease regulation (13 papers), Cancer-related molecular mechanisms research (11 papers) and RNA modifications and cancer (5 papers). Simonas Juzėnas collaborates with scholars based in Lithuania, Germany and Latvia. Simonas Juzėnas's co-authors include Limas Kupčinskas, Juozas Kupčinskas, Jurgita Skiecevičienė, Alexander Link, André Franke, Gediminas Kiudelis, Mārcis Leja, Peter Malfertheiner, Georg Hemmrich‐Stanisak and Matthias Hübenthal and has published in prestigious journals such as Science, Nucleic Acids Research and Nature Communications.
